When I walked in on Monday at 7 there was only 1 couple dining. But several others were ordering takeout or door dash. The atmosphere was simple, but clean. There was a semi open kitchen and a sushi bar. I ordered an appetizer, wine and a hibachi meal. The flow seemed a bit rushed. My salad came first... very typical with a nice dressing. There were 8 pieces of Crab Rangoon with a sweet/sour dipping sauce. I ate all of them, but they didn't blow me away... mostly tasted of sweet cream cheese. Before I could finish my appetizer, the hibachi steak with vegetables and fried rice came out with yum yum sauce. I ordered medium rare. I was only given a fork and a napkin, but I could tell without cutting the steak that it was overcooked. I was chewing on the meat for longer than it should have taken. I opted to take home half of the entree and received a small box. I was delighted that for everything I got it was only $35. However, if it costed more I definitely wouldn't go back to try something else on a different night of the week.
The other couple were raving about the sushi and said they would be back.
The server recommended the ramen to them. Perhaps I will go back to try that another time.

We went on a Tuesday night. They were about half full with just one server for the whole floor. She was really running (literally, at times) in all directions trying to keep up. So it took quite a while to get drinks and put in our order. The food came out pretty quickly.
The calamari was poor. All batter, no meat, over cooked. But the dipping sauces were good. The salad dressing completely separated - ginger on the top leaves of iceberg lettuce, water at the bottom of the bowl.
The hibachi entrees (steak/chicken and steak/shrimp) were pretty average. Well cooked and generous portions, but the steak was pretty tough.
Had we gotten egg rolls or gyoza instead of calamari and ordered it all for pick up, I think we would have given it a much better rating.
